UMMC Midtown Campus, part of the University of Maryland Medical Center, is committed to community health and excellence in patient care. Located in Baltimore’s cultural hub, it is a 144-bed teaching hospital offering extensive outpatient services. Our mission is to partner with patients to achieve optimal health, managing primary care needs and conditions such as diabetes, hypertension, and more.

Position: Experienced Certified Wound Care Nurse

Type: Full-time, Days, with a $20,000 Sign-on Bonus

The nurse will demonstrate leadership, advance evidence-based practices, lead governance initiatives, and coach staff. Responsibilities include:

  1. Clinical Practice: Providing independent care, serving as a resource, integrating evidence into practice, and functioning in unit-specific roles.
  2. Service/Quality: Leading quality improvement efforts, monitoring safety standards, and leading research projects.
  3. Unit Operations: Performing charge roles, overseeing orientation, mentoring staff, and promoting a healthy work environment.
  4. Professional Development: Mentoring, coaching, and leading unit development initiatives.
Qualifications
  • RN licensure in Maryland or eligibility through Compact agreements
  • BSN degree required
  • WOCN certification
  • Current CPR certification
  • Relevant clinical experience and ongoing education
  • Membership in a professional organization
Additional Requirements
  • Specialty certification or recent relevant education or participation in professional activities
  • Ability to assume a leadership role and work effectively in a team
  • Proficiency in computer systems and patient care principles
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
Safety & Compensation
  • Ensuring patient safety and reporting risks
  • Pay Range: $36.50-$49.39
  • Additional compensation includes shift differentials and a sign-on bonus
